Raptors' Jakob Poeltl: Swats three shots Wednesday
Rotowire
Poeltl contributed eight points (4-7 FG), five rebounds and three blocks in 30 minutes during Wednesday's 122-111 loss to the Pelicans.
Poeltl had minimal production offensively in his return from a one-game absence due to an illness, but he contributed defensively with a game-high three blocks that also tied a season high. Since returning from an extended absence due to a back strain, Poeltl has averaged 10.2 points, 6.7 rebounds, 1.8 assists, 1.2 blocks and 1.0 steals over 26.1 minutes per game.

Raptors' Jakob Poeltl: Strong double-double in win
Rotowire
Poeltl finished with 16 points (8-9 FG), 10 rebounds, four assists, two blocks and one steal across 30 minutes during Sunday's 122-92 win over the Mavericks.
Poeltl is seemingly turning a corner with his back issue and is trending up in fantasy hoops. Over his last five games, he's been a second-round value in nine-category leagues with averages of 13.4 points, 8.2 rebounds, 2.6 assists, 1.4 steals and 1.6 blocks in 28.8 minutes per contest.

Raptors' Jakob Poeltl: Strong two-way performance
Rotowire
Poeltl chipped in 18 points (7-7 FG, 4-5 FT), 10 rebounds, three assists, one block and three steals in 26 minutes before fouling out of Saturday's 134-125 victory over Washington.
Poeltl had arguably his best overall performance of the season, logging at least 26 minutes for the second straight game. The big man has dealt with back issues throughout the campaign, though he finally appears to be healthy. After being dropped in many leagues, and rightfully so, managers should check to see if he is somehow available. While the back could flare up again at any point, now is as good a time as ever to take a chance on a player who has been a proven top-70 asset in the past.

Raptors' Jakob Poeltl: Quiet in return to lineup
Rotowire
Poeltl (back) finished with nine points (4-7 FG, 1-2 FT) and six rebounds in 20 minutes during Wednesday's 113-95 loss to the Pistons.
Seeing his first game action since Dec. 21, Poeltl was on a tight minutes restriction but didn't seem hampered by the back issues that had kept him sidelined for 24 consecutive games. The veteran center will get the All-Star break to rest up further, but he may need more time after that to ramp up before he'll be allowed to handle a full workload.

Raptors' Jakob Poeltl: Could return before All-Star break
Rotowire
Raptors head coach Darko Rajakovic said Thursday that Poeltl (back) has been "reacting really well" to his recent on-court work, and the Raptors are hopeful he can return before the All-Star break, Blake Murphy of Sportsnet.ca reports.
Poeltl has already been ruled out for Thursday's game against the Bulls, but if he's able to increase his workload in practice Saturday, he may have a chance at playing as soon as Sunday's game versus the Pacers or next Wednesday's game against the Pistons. Given that he's been out since Dec. 21 due to a lower-back strain, Poeltl is likely to have some restrictions once he's cleared to play again, but he may be worth grabbing in certain leagues if he's sitting on a waiver wire. Collin Murray-Boyles and Sandro Mamukelashvili will both see their respective fantasy values take a hit once Poeltl is back in the mix and fully up to speed.
